What is PA D-1 Form

The PA Schedule D-1 Installment Sale Income Calculation is a Pennsylvania state tax form used by residents to calculate taxable installment sale income from property sales.

What is the PA Schedule D-1 Installment Sale Income Calculation?

The PA Schedule D-1 form is a crucial document for Pennsylvania taxpayers that focuses on the calculation of installment sale income. This form helps determine the taxable income derived from sales of property, both real and tangible personal. Accurate reporting through the PA Schedule D-1 ensures compliance with Pennsylvania tax regulations, preventing potential issues during tax season.
Understanding the installment sale income calculation is essential for taxpayers to report their earnings correctly. Proper use of this form safeguards against discrepancies and minimizes the risk of incurring tax penalties.

Required Information for Completing the PA Schedule D-1

To accurately complete the PA Schedule D-1 form, taxpayers must gather specific information related to their installment sale. Required fields typically include the selling price, cost basis, and any applicable expenses related to the sale.
  • Document the selling price and associated costs.
  • Prepare any necessary supporting documentation like sale contracts and proof of payment.
  • Gather information on depreciation, if applicable.
Collecting this data beforehand can greatly streamline the completion process, ensuring all entries are accurate and supported by necessary documentation.

The PA Schedule D-1 must be filed by Pennsylvania residents who have sold property via an installment sale and need to report the income from that sale on their tax return.
You will need information regarding the sale such as the selling price, cost basis, total depreciation, and any expenses related to the sale to accurately complete the PA Schedule D-1.
Completed PA Schedule D-1 forms can be submitted electronically or mailed to the Pennsylvania Department of Revenue as part of your PA tax return. Ensure you follow the latest submission guidelines.
Common mistakes include leaving fields blank, miscalculating the installment sale income, and not attaching necessary supporting documents. Always double-check your entries for accuracy.
No, notarization is not required for the PA Schedule D-1 form. You only need to ensure that your information is accurate and complete before submission.
The PA Schedule D-1 should be submitted by the due date of your Pennsylvania tax return, which is typically April 15 for most taxpayers. Be sure to check for any extensions or changes due to special circumstances.
